Key Characteristics of Counterfeit Money

Understanding how to recognize counterfeit notes helps in the fight against this problem. Here are some common qualities that help in detection:

  1. Watermarks: Genuine currency frequently features unique watermarks that are challenging to duplicate.

  2. Color-Shifting Ink: Many modern banknotes use ink that alters color when viewed from various angles.

  3. Microprinting: Small text that is difficult to see with the naked eye however is present on legitimate notes is frequently missing or duplicated badly on counterfeit expenses.

  4. Feel and Texture: Genuine money is printed on an unique type of paper, giving it a particular feel. Counterfeit notes typically feel various, as they might be printed on routine paper.

  5. Security Threads: This ingrained thread is a typical security feature in many banknotes.

Despite these functions, counterfeiters have developed increasingly sophisticated techniques that in some cases can trick even precise people.

The Legal Landscape of Counterfeiting

Counterfeiting is a crime in virtually every nation on the planet. The legal ramifications can be severe, including everything from large fines to substantial jail sentences. Additionally, legislation is constantly adapted to resolve brand-new approaches of counterfeiting.

In the United States, for instance, the Secret Service was initially established to combat currency counterfeiting and has stayed at the leading edge of this battle. They utilize various methods, including public education, to assist citizens recognize counterfeit money.

Legal Consequences of Counterfeiting

The repercussions of counterfeiting can differ based upon jurisdiction but typically consist of:

  • Criminal Charges: Most nations classify counterfeiting as a felony or severe offense.
  • Fines: Offenders might be required to pay substantial financial fines.
  • Jail time: Convictions can result in prolonged prison sentences.
  • Restitution: In some cases, counterfeiters may be bought to repay victims.

Counterfeit Money in the Digital Age

With the increase of digital technology, consisting of 3D printing and advanced graphics software application, the process of developing counterfeit currency has become more available. This technological development presents obstacles to law enforcement and banks making every effort to protect the integrity of international currencies.

Measures to Combat Counterfeiting

In reaction to these obstacles, monetary organizations, governments, and law enforcement agencies have implemented different protective measures, including:

  • Advanced Security Features: Continuous enhancement in the security functions of banknotes, consisting of holograms and complex styles.

  • Public Awareness Campaigns: Educating residents on how to detect counterfeit notes and report suspicious activities.

  • Cooperation Between Agencies: Cooperation in between international police and monetary entities is essential in finding and prosecuting counterfeiters.
